Finnish passport holders need a visa to enter Pakistan in 2026. Apply online through the official visa portal before you travel — there are no visa-on-arrival options for Finnish citizens. Processing can take a week or more, so plan ahead.

Visa required — no exceptions
Finnish passport holders cannot enter Pakistan without a pre-approved visa. There is no visa-on-arrival or eTA scheme. Apply online at least 2 weeks before departure.
Passport validity counts from entry date
Your passport must be valid for 6 months from the day you land in Pakistan, not from the day you apply. If your passport expires in 5 months, renew it first.

What happens at the border

1
Apply for your visa online
Go to visa.nadra.gov.pk and fill out the application. Upload a passport-style photo and scanned passport bio page. Pay the fee online (around €30–€60 depending on visa type). Processing takes 5–10 working days.
2
Receive your visa decision
Check your email and the portal for updates. If approved, you'll get an e-visa PDF or a visa sticker authorization. Print a copy and save it on your phone.
3
Arrive at a Pakistani airport
At Islamabad, Karachi, or Lahore airport, go to the 'Foreigners' queue. Hand over your passport, visa printout, and boarding pass. The officer may ask for your return ticket and hotel address. Answer clearly — they're used to tourists.
4
Get your passport stamped
The officer will stamp your passport with entry date and duration of stay. Check the stamp says the correct number of days (usually 30 or 90 depending on your visa). Keep the stamp visible — you'll need it for exit.

Health & vaccines for Pakistan

Required for entry
Yellow FeverRequired if arriving from a country with yellow fever transmission.
Recommended vaccines
Hepatitis AEssentialTyphoidEssentialHepatitis BRecommendedRabiesConsider
Health risks
MalariaHigh risk

Present in many areas, especially rural; prophylaxis recommended.

Dengue feverModerate risk

Occurs in urban and rural areas; mosquito avoidance advised.

Food and waterborne diseasesHigh risk

Common due to contaminated food/water; practice safe eating and drinking.

Malaria risk: high

Risk is high in most areas below 2000m, especially in rural regions. Prophylaxis recommended.

Based on CDC and WHO guidance. Consult a travel medicine clinic 4–6 weeks before departure for personalised advice.
